Rhea Chakraborty Reveals Loosing Everything After Sushant Singh Rajput’s Death Controversy. More Details Inside!

Rhea Chakraborty has finally spoken out about the professional and personal damage that ensued after Sushant Singh Rajput’s death in 2020. In a recent interview, she exposed how the controversy storm didn’t just put her acting career on hold but also derailed the future of her brother, Showik Chakraborty. After Sushant’s untimely death in June 2020, Rhea found herself in the middle of a media and judicial storm.

Rhea Chakraborty On Life After Sushant Singh Rajput’s Death

During an interview with CNBC-18, Rhea spoke about she and her brother Showik were detained by the Narcotics Control Bureau in relation to a narcotics investigation, which arose in the wake of the case. Although both were later let out, the harm had already been inflicted.

Looking back on those tough days, Rhea said that opportunities at work in the film industry vanished overnight. Scripts ceased to come in for her. For Showik, matters weren’t any different, having achieved a high 96 percentile in the CAT and bagging a spot at a premier business school, the arrest made him unable to start his MBA. Rhea also talked about how being away during the first semester wrecked his study plans and future ambitions.

Furthermore, attempting to return to the workplace was very tough for Showik, given the high level of media attention around their names, most corporate recruiters weren’t prepared to take a risk, Rhea revealed. “We didn’t know what to do next,” she declared, explaining that the ambiguity left them looking for guidance.

Rather than giving up, the brothers chose to forge their own way. From that, Chapter 2 Drip was born, a streetwear apparel brand built around self-expression and representation. The business gave them a new sense of purpose and was part of their healing process. The two celebrated the opening of their brand’s first physical store on May 24 in Mumbai, even performing a small puja to bless the place. Finally, after all the legal wrangling and harsh public censure for years, in May 2024, the Central Bureau of Investigation filed a closure report formally exonerating both Rhea and Showik of all allegations connected with Sushant’s death.

Back in the world of entertainment, Rhea returned last year on MTV Roadies as a gang leader and went on to win the season. Although she returned this year, the trophy was handed over to YouTuber Elvish Yadav.
